Utah lawmaker clarifies gun rights amid misinformation on youth firearm legislation
The recent government meeting in Utah focused on significant discussions surrounding gun legislation and public safety, particularly in light of a recent incident involving a young person and a firearm. A participant shared a personal experience about a friend's accidental shooting, highlighting concerns about firearm safety among the younger generation. This prompted a broader conversation about the need for safety training and proficiency in handling firearms.

The meeting addressed the implications of a gun recodification bill, which aimed to clarify existing laws regarding firearm possession and rights in Utah. It was noted that 18-year-olds in Utah can already openly carry a pistol, although they cannot purchase one until they are 21. The bill sought to streamline and clarify the state's confusing gun laws, which had become a "hodgepodge" of conflicting statutes over the years.

Despite passing in the House, the bill faced challenges in the Senate but was ultimately incorporated into another piece of legislation that passed. Officials emphasized the importance of understanding Second Amendment rights and the need for clear legal language to help residents know their rights regarding self-defense.

Concerns were raised about misinformation in the media regarding the bill, which some participants felt misrepresented the legislation's intent. The discussion underscored the need for accurate reporting and public understanding of gun laws, as well as the importance of responsible firearm ownership and safety education.
